Pre-Surgery Preparations: What to Expect
Before you go through vision adjustment surgery, it's important to understand the prep work entailed.
Initially, your eye doctor will carry out an extensive eye test to identify your qualification for the procedure. You'll require to provide a full medical history, going over any type of medicines and health conditions.
If you use contact lenses, your medical professional might ask you to stop wearing them for a few weeks prior to the surgical treatment to allow your eyes to return to their all-natural form.
You should arrange for someone to drive you home after the procedure, as you'll likely experience some short-lived vision modifications.
Lastly, adhere to any type of pre-operative directions your physician offers you, consisting of standards on consuming and drinking prior to the surgery.
Being well-prepared can assist guarantee a smoother experience.
The Surgical Procedure: Step-by-Step
Once you've completed the pre-surgery preparations, the procedure itself will begin.
You'll be taken to the operating room, where you'll lie down comfortably. The doctor will begin by administering numbing eye decreases, guaranteeing you will not really feel any kind of discomfort.
Next off, they'll position a little device to maintain your eye open. Using a laser, the cosmetic surgeon will certainly produce a slim flap on the cornea, then gently lift it.
After that, they'll reshape your cornea with accuracy lasers, fixing your vision. Once https://www.webmd.com/eye-health/news/20180320/patients-regain-sight-from-stem-cell-transplant improving is full, the flap is repositioned, and you'll be led to unwind while the procedure concludes.
The whole procedure normally takes around 15 mins per eye, so you'll be in and out prior to you recognize it.
Post-Operative Care and Healing Tips
Taking care of your eyes after surgery is critical for a smooth healing. Initially, follow your surgeon's guidelines very closely regarding drugs and eye decreases. You'll intend to keep your eyes oiled and without infection.
Avoid scrubing your eyes and shield them from bright lights and dust by putting on sunglasses when outdoors. Rest is essential; offer your eyes a break from screens and reading for the initial couple of days.
Don't neglect to attend your follow-up consultations to track your progression. If you experience any kind of unusual discomfort, redness, or vision adjustments, contact your physician quickly.
Last but not least, stay moisturized and maintain a healthy and balanced diet regimen to support your recovery procedure. With these suggestions, you'll be on your way to clear vision in a snap!
